Responsibilities               

  • Install, maintain, repair, replace and calibrate instrumentation on compression, gathering, treating and processing equipment, and control equipment such as PLCs, temperature scanners, engine annunciators, compressor panel boards and ignition controllers.

  • Install, maintain, repair, replace and calibrate instrumentation, plant controllers, recorders and indicators (pneumatic and electric), chromatograph analyzers, and gas detectors (portable and stationary).

  • Install conduit and wiring to electrical devices, in plants, compressor stations and other gathering, treating and processing facilities.

  • Install, maintain repair and calibrate Ph, Conductivity, ORP, gas flow and dew point meters and collect meter data.

  • Assist in new construction and modification to processing, treating, compressor stations and gathering equipment. Also assist in the startup of this equipment.

  • Complete periodic maintenance and annual safety checks on equipment shuts downs for processing, compressor, treating and gathering equipment.

  • Support operating personnel in daily activities of operating processing, treating, compression and gathering systems.

  • Attend and participate in safety meetings, incident audits and safety and environmental audits.

  • Occasionally asked to supervise and inspect the work of outside vendors and contractors.
